**Q: When is it safe to archive a cold storage bucket?**

A bucket in the Drayloft platform may be archived once it has had no reads for 90 consecutive days, carries no active legal hold, and has passed checksum verification. Archiving is reversible for 30 days, after which restores require a formal request. Always record the archive decision in the ledger first. The complete procedure and exception list are documented here.

wiki page, tahaf-tajog: https://jira.ordindyn.corp/pipeline

# Divestiture: Harlick Components Unit

**Restricted — Managers Only**

Sale of the Harlick unit to Perrow Holdings closes next quarter. Sales leads: stop new multi-year commitments on Harlick SKUs immediately. Existing contracts transfer at close. Customer messaging comes from corporate comms only; do not comment externally. Commission treatment for in-flight deals will be confirmed separately. The rationale is summarized below.

internal memo for hahaf-kahof: Only 39 of the 428 pilot accounts renewed Sorion, so a churn review is set for April 12. Praokix Freight is in early talks to buy Queniusox Group for about $145.8 million.

- [ ] Mail room relocation: note that the mail room at Varnley House has moved from the ground floor to Level 2, beside the Copperfield Lift lobby. Contractors collecting parcels should sign the visitor ledger at the Level 2 desk first, then proceed through the secured corridor on the left. The corridor door requires the temporary pass code issued to contractors, shown below.

staff pass of kawip-hawef = bdg-QLP-2